Rutherford finds the “nucleus” by bouncing alpha particles; Bohr adds “steps” (quantised levels) to make spectra fit.
Isotopes share Z, differ in A by changing neutrons (neutrons = A − Z).
Pauli: 2 per box; Hund: spread first; Aufbau: fill lowest energy first.
Big jump = next shell inward; small steps = same shell being stripped.
Last electron decides the block: s→s-block, p→p-block, d→d-block, f→f-block.
Cr and Cu “prefer” 3d⁵4s¹ (half) and 3d¹⁰4s¹ (full), even if that means shifting from the simple fill pattern.
Unpaired electron = dot (free radical); metal ion loses outer electrons first.

Comparison of atomic models
| Model | Main idea | Key limitation |
|---|---|---|
| Thomson model | Atom contains sub-atomic particles (electrons) and is divisible | Couldn’t explain atomic spectral lines and failed to explain proton concentration in a nucleus. |
| Rutherford model | Atom is mostly empty space with a dense positive nucleus | Failed to explain spectral lines produced by atoms. |
| Bohr model | Electrons move in fixed energy levels and jump with quantised energy | Failed to explain spectral lines for multi-electron atoms and treated electrons only as particles. |
